Pb d'envoie mail avec fonction mail() php, chez FREE

goliath31
Invité n'ayant pas de compte PHPfrance

30 sept. 2008, 21:27

Bonjour,

Sur mon site Internet programmé en PHP, j'ai un problème quand je veux envoyer des mails.

Voici le problème :
Je dois envoyer un mail à env. 100 personnes. Donc, j'appelle la fonction mail() de PHP, 100 fois.
Les 32 premiers mails marchent, et au 33ème mail, voici le message d'erreur qui s'affiche :

Fatal error: mail() [<a href='function.mail'>function.mail</a>]: Fonction mail() bloque. in /mnt/167/sda/1/7/alabreche/Include/fonction.php on line 310

Mon hébergeur est free. Serait-il possible que Free limite l'envoie de mail, de cette manière ?

Comment donc puis-je faire pour envoyer mes mails à tout le monde ?

Qqn peut-il m'aider ?

Merci d'avance

ViPHP
AB
ViPHP | 5818 Messages

30 sept. 2008, 22:04

Il me semble que free limite le nombre d'envoi de mail à un certain quota.
Sinon plutôt de d'utiliser 100 fois la fonction mail, tu pourrais peut-être ne l'utiliser qu'une fois avec l'adresse des 100 destinataires (en les séparant par une virgule).

Petit nouveau ! | 1 Messages

31 oct. 2008, 12:49

Salut.
Perso, j'utilise le script "phpMyNewsletter_0.8beta5" qui jusque là fonctionnait très bien chez free. Je viens de réinstaller le script, mais rien ni fait. Apparemment il y a eu des modifs sur le serveur. Ma dernière newsletter date du 12 septembre, et je l'ai envoyée à environs 250 adresses mail sans soucie. Si jamais vous aviez d'autres infos, je suis preneur. En attendant, je repart à la pêche aux infos...

[Note : ce message a été posté de manière anonyme avant d'être réattribué à son auteur]

Administrateur PHPfrance
Administrateur PHPfrance | 11457 Messages

31 oct. 2008, 13:13

Modération :
Afin d'obtenir plus de réponses, le sujet est déplacé dans le forum "PHP débutant".

Administrateur PHPfrance
Administrateur PHPfrance | 11457 Messages

31 oct. 2008, 13:13


ViPHP
AB
ViPHP | 5818 Messages

02 nov. 2008, 23:41

Je ne peux qu'appuyer la dernière réponse d'albat : avec un service gratuit il serait illusoire de prétendre à un service haut de gamme.

Il est néanmoins très possible que tu puisses résoudre ton pb d'une manière ou d'une autre. Cela dit, ce que tu nous indique de ton site ressemble plus à une utilisation professionnelle. Alors pour quelques dizaines d'euros par an...

Je ne dis pas qu'il n'y aurait aucun problème, mais au moins tu partirais sur une base plus adaptée.